The 3-Tier Multidisciplinary Diabetes Reversal Model

Recognising that diabetes is rarely a purely nutritional issue - but rather a chronic condition shaped by diet, lifestyle, and medical management working together - Dr Julie Ng built a care model that brings together three distinct professional disciplines rather than relying on a single point of intervention:

Tier 1 - Dr Julie Ng, Diabetes Reversal Expert. Dr Julie personally oversees the design and strategic direction of every patient's programme, conducting comprehensive health assessments, analysing HbA1c and blood test results, evaluating dietary history, and developing a customised diet plan aimed not just at lowering glucose readings, but at improving the patient's underlying insulin sensitivity.

Tier 2 - A Dedicated Nutritionist Team. Because sustainable diabetes reversal depends on daily execution, not one-off advice, a team of nutritionists provides continuous one-on-one support throughout each patient's journey - including daily dietary monitoring, meal planning, guidance for eating out, post-meal glucose pattern review, and ongoing nutrition education.

Tier 3 - Medical Specialist Oversight. For patients on diabetes medication or insulin therapy, specialist doctors within Dr Julie Ng's care network monitor glucose trends, assess treatment progress, and safely adjust medication or insulin dosages as dietary improvements take effect - minimising the risk of hypoglycaemia and ensuring that any reduction in medication is medically supervised rather than self-directed.

This tri-professional structure - diabetes reversal strategy, daily nutritional coaching, and medical oversight - is designed to give patients a level of safety and continuity that a single-discipline approach cannot offer, while ensuring medication decisions always remain in the hands of qualified physicians.

Programme Structure

  • Patients enrolled under Dr Julie Ng's programme typically undergo a structured, minimum 100-day journey, delivered through:

  • One-on-one online consultations conducted via Zoom

  • At least 100 days of continuous WhatsApp-based diet coaching, with Medical Specialist involvement for patients currently on diabetes medication or insulin

  • A fully customised diet plan built around each patient's individual health assessment and blood test results

The consistency of this daily follow-up structure is, in Dr Julie Ng's view, the single most important factor separating patients who achieve lasting results from those who see only temporary improvement.
